We don't stop sailing because we get old

by Steve Cockerill, Rooster Sailing 28 Nov 2006 07:35 GMT

We get old because we stop sailing!

Written by a 75+ year old who’s in love with dinghy sailing still!

    Having reached the young age of 75+years, diagnosed of having angina in January 2006, - a stent fitted April 2006, I decided that in addition to the somewhat challenging Albacore I required a single-handed boat which would be kinder to an elderly gentleman.

    I have been racing competitively for more than 40 years, mainly in Albacores at club, national and international level. Sailed and raced cruisers, single-handed boats - Finn, Europe, Supernova, Laser (full and radial rig) and currently race a modern FRP Albacore.

    I had the good fortune of knowing Steve Cockerill of Rooster Sailing who introduced me to the Streaker by loaning me the demo boat for evaluation. In September 2006, I raced the Streaker twice in force 5-6 winds in Chichester harbour. The boat showed exemplary manners with its stayed mast and uni-rig sail plan, low weight, low grunt factor, good positive rudder response, and most of all it was very kind to an older helmsman (no capsizing even in those winds) and on handicap finished in a very creditable position. Sailing a Streaker is infectious, once you have tried it nothing else is quite the same, lots of fun, easy to handle (on land or water) no matter how old or inexperienced the helm might be.

Verdict: 'This is a great little boat'
